PUBLIC LAW 108–173—DEC. 8, 2003 (1) ADJUSTMENT IN PRACTICE EXPENSE RELATIVE VALUE 1848(c)(2) (42 U.S.C. 1395w–4(c)(2)) is UNITS.—Section amended— (A) in subparagraph (B)— (i) in clause (ii)(II), by striking ‘‘The adjustments’’ and inserting ‘‘Subject to clause (iv), the adjustments’’; and (ii) by adding at the end of subparagraph (B), the following new clause: ‘‘(iv) EXEMPTION FROM BUDGET NEUTRALITY.—The additional expenditures attributable to— ‘‘(I) subparagraph (H) shall not be taken into account in applying clause (ii)(II) for 2004; ‘‘(II) subparagraph (I) insofar as it relates to a physician fee schedule for 2005 or 2006 shall not be taken into account in applying clause (ii)(II) for drug administration services under the fee schedule for such year for a specialty described in subparagraph (I)(ii)(II); and ‘‘(III) subparagraph (J) insofar as it relates to a physician fee schedule for 2005 or 2006 shall not be taken into account in applying clause (ii)(II) for drug administration services under the fee schedule for such year.’’; and (B) by adding at the end the following new subparagraphs: ‘‘(H) ADJUSTMENTS IN PRACTICE EXPENSE RELATIVE VALUE UNITS FOR CERTAIN DRUG ADMINISTRATION SERVICES BEGINNING IN 2004.— ‘‘(i) USE OF SURVEY DATA.—In establishing the

physician fee schedule under subsection (b) with respect to payments for services furnished on or after January 1, 2004, the Secretary shall, in determining practice expense relative value units under this subsection, utilize a survey submitted to the Secretary as of January 1, 2003, by a physician specialty organization pursuant to section 212 of the Medicare, Medicaid, and SCHIP Balanced Budget Refinement Act of 1999 if the survey— ‘‘(I) covers practice expenses for oncology drug administration services; and ‘‘(II) meets criteria established by the Secretary for acceptance of such surveys. ‘‘(ii) PRICING OF CLINICAL ONCOLOGY NURSES IN PRACTICE EXPENSE METHODOLOGY.—If the survey described in clause (i) includes data on wages, salaries, and compensation of clinical oncology nurses, the Secretary shall utilize such data in the methodology for determining practice expense relative value units under subsection (c). ‘‘(iii) WORK RELATIVE VALUE UNITS FOR CERTAIN DRUG ADMINISTRATION SERVICES.—In establishing the relative value units under this paragraph for drug administration services described in clause (iv) furnished on or after January 1, 2004, the Secretary shall establish work relative value units equal to the work
